Behind The Lens
Location
This picture was taken on the Isle of Skye in Scotland. The bridge is in place called SligachanTime
The picture was taken in the early afternoon.Lighting
Lighting was very diffused due to overcast and cloudy skies.Equipment
I used a Canon 5D MK III with a 24-70mm f2.8L lens. Also a Manfrotto tripod with a LEE ND Big stopper with a ND Grad filter.Inspiration
The shear beauty of this place is very inspiring.Editing
I used Lightroom to do my post processing.In my camera bag
I carry a wide angle lens and super telephoto. I carry LEE filters and spare batteries. I use a Sekonic light meter as well when shooting manual.Feedback
Don't be turned off by the weather. The clouds were great. I also had an umbrella with me to keep the lens dry as there was a light rain.
